Meet Cheyne Dorsey
Cheyne (pronounced as SHAYN) is a licensed barber, cosmetic tattoo artist, educator, entrepreneur, and professional photographer based in New Mexico. He has owned and operated his barbershop since 2019 — building it into a space where everyone is welcome, where real conversations happen, and where people leave feeling more like themselves.
Because for Cheyne, it has always been more than a haircut.

The Multiple Standards of Cheyne
Building a Strong Foundation
Before expanding into multiple industries, Cheyne earned a Bachelor of Liberal Arts with focuses in Business Administration and Communications, followed by a Master's degree in Sports Administration, from the University of New Mexico. His education provided an additional foundation for the work he continues to build today.
A Foundation Built on Service
In 2025, Cheyne designed and built his own mobile barbershop entirely by hand — a first-of-its-kind luxury service on wheels and the only mobile barbershop in the state of New Mexico. Built to bring a premium experience directly to clients wherever they are, and to reach people who might not otherwise have easy access to a professional cut, the mobile shop is a living expression of everything he stands for: craftsmanship, independence, and using what you have built to serve others well.
Innovation Through Craftsmanship
Since 2022, Cheyne has also practiced scalp micropigmentation as a licensed cosmetic tattoo artist — one of the most specialized and transformative services in the industry. SMP sits at the intersection of artistry, precision, and confidence restoration, and it reflects the same philosophy that runs through every service he offers: give people something that makes them feel whole.
The Art of Transformation
For over a decade, Cheyne has worked as a professional photographer — an eye for detail and composition that shapes everything from how he approaches a client's look to how he builds a brand. His visual instincts run through every aspect of The Industry Standard.
